Interpreting remainders is one of the most challenging skills to teach. Students often lack the real-world experiences these questions refer to, making our job as teachers even more difficult. So, what can we do to help students overcome these challenges? In this week’s episode, I share two small changes to my instruction that made a big difference in not only my ability to teach this lesson but also my students' ability to understand. I explain how to use a 3-step CPA approach (concrete, pictorial, and abstract) to help students gain a conceptual understanding of interpreting remainders.  This week’s episode covers Day 1 of teaching interpreting remainders in the concrete and pictorial phases of the CPA approach. I give suggestions for manipulatives to use in the concrete phase along with sample questions to use with your students. Next week’s episode will cover Day 2 in the abstract phase along with ideas for small group instruction.
